ZIP 30248 and ZIP 30256 are ZIP Code areas in Georgia. This page compares them across population, income, housing, education, commuting, and how each has changed since 2019.

ZIP 30248 has the higher population (33,837 vs 3,007 in ZIP 30256). ZIP 30248 has the higher median household income ($85,458 vs $80,263 in ZIP 30256). ZIP 30248 has the higher median home value ($275,000 vs $195,400 in ZIP 30256).
